... have any legs to stand on.
The rumor was CU board of regents will vote on Monday to leave PAC 12. CU AD vehemently denies that rumor saying unequivocally there will be no vote on Monday.
Then I heard that any vote taken by the regents must be in open session and the meeting on Monday was an executive (closed) session.
Then I heard that the topic on leaving the PAC 12 was on the agenda for Monday. Then I heard that the regents would be given the information on Monday and if they were favorable to leaving the PAC 12, they would vote to do so at the next public meeting.
So, I tried to track it down. Here is what I found - 1. There is a closed session meeting on Monday. 2. The only item on the agenda is "Legal advice on a specific matter - athletic matters." (Link provided below) 3. There is a public meeting set for April 27th.
I can see how it is possible that the board could be getting all the info on Monday, and then vote to leave on 4/27. Not saying it will happen, just saying it could. I will not be surprised no matter how it ends up. But, I would lean toward thinking that the regents will vote to leave PAC 12 on the 27th.
Here is a cut and paste of the agenda for the notification of the meeting on Monday. You have to click on the meeting and then clock on agenda to get to the agenda.
https://go.boarddocs.com/co/cu/Board.nsf/vpublic?open
Here is a cut and paste of the agenda.
******** RESOLVED that the Board of Regents go into executive session. As permitted by section 24-6-402 (3), Colorado Revised Statutes, the board will discuss the following matter as announced and pursuant to the subsection as listed below: - (a)(II), Legal advice on a specific matter - athletics matters **********
